Jonathan M. Jacobs has authored 52 papers that have received a total of 799 indexed citations.
This includes 47 papers in Plant Science, 13 papers in Cell Biology and 3 papers in Endocrinology. The topics of these papers are Plant Pathogenic Bacteria Studies (45 papers), Plant-Microbe Interactions and Immunity (36 papers) and Legume Nitrogen Fixing Symbiosis (21 papers). Jonathan M. Jacobs is often cited by papers focused on Plant Pathogenic Bacteria Studies (45 papers), Plant-Microbe Interactions and Immunity (36 papers) and Legume Nitrogen Fixing Symbiosis (21 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and Réunion. Jonathan M. Jacobs's co-authors include Caitilyn Allen, Ralf Koebnik, Verónica Román-Reyna, Jillian M. Lang and Janet Ziegle and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Scientific Reports and New Phytologist.
